Legal Studies Degree

The legal studies degree program at Culver – Stockton College is a general studies program that includes instruction for students that focuses on law and legal issues from the perspective of the social sciences and humanities. Students who graduate from the legal studies degree program may pursue careers in law enforcement, legal administration, correctional facilities, and may become detectives, investigators, paralegals, and more. C-SC is a nonprofit private institution located in Canton, Missouri and provides a large number of program options for students. The school's Christian Church (Disciples of Christ) affiliation is one of its defining characteristics and plays an important role within the school's mission. The school's small size in terms of enrollment, around 770 students, offers students a more hands on education due to the size of the class and easier access to faculty.

The admissions process will include the submission of an application, transcripts, records, and test scores, which are then reviewed by the admissions office. Students may take either the ACT or SAT exam scores to be considered for admissions at C-SC. A score in a range of 790 to 1080 on the SAT, or 18 to 24 for the ACT is common among admitted students. This school has an acceptance rate of about 66% of which only 23% decided to enroll. More information regarding admissions can be found at culver.edu.

The cost of tuition is close to $25,000, but may change from year to year. Students are encouraged to use the school's price of attendance calculator to better understand their personal tuition costs. Student housing is available on-campus for students. The yearly cost of housing is approximately $3,700. Students enrolled at this school may qualify for aid which is generally scholarships, grants, and loans.
